check and make sure your brake light s work, if they don't the shifter is locked out, it is a safety feature to make sure your foot is on the brake when u shift into drive or reverse.
leaking fluid will not cause a brake to lock up unless the wheel cylinder is leaking and caused the brake shoe to swell. If so, you need a new wheel cylinder.
The gear selector is locked until the system detects the brake pedal is being pressed, the brake circuit then sends a signal to the shifter release solenoid to pull a pin back and let you shift out of park, this is a safety feature required by federal law, U need to have someone see if the brake lights go on when you press the pedal, if they don't check the switch at the top of the brake pedal, if the brake lights work then the little solenoid is defective.
